Acrossair: Augmented Reality Brower for the iPhone 3GS
Author: admin | Filed under: Video, softwareHere’s a promo video of the Acrossair augmented reality browser. Using the iPhone 3GS camera, GPS, compass and Google Maps, this browser gives the user a sort of info HUD of the shopping and entertainment availabilities around them. By clicking on a category such as “restaurants”, the user can actually turn and see what eateries are around them in the surrounding area. You can also lay the iPhone flat to get a Google Maps view that also maintains the correct orientation no matter where you turn. Just watch the video, it’ll make a lot more sense:
